Effect of heat on static withdrawal resistance of plain shank nails in some Australian timbers
Heat energy was conducted along embedded shank and dissipated into surrounding timber fibers; three Australian timbers were used in study which included examination of density, moisture content and levels of thermal induction; statistical study was undertaken to determine relationship between nail diameter, penetration and maximum withdrawal resistance; equations derived relate diameter and penetration of plain shank nail with its withdrawal resistance value for varying thermal levels, timber densities and moisture conditions.
